Lộ trình Blockchain Developer: Từ lý thuyết đến ứng dụng thực tế
Lộ trình Blockchain Developer: Từ lý thuyết đến ứng dụng thực tế
Bạn đam mê công nghệ blockchain và muốn trở thành một Blockchain Developer chuyên nghiệp? Lộ trình Blockchain Developer: Từ lý thuyết đến ứng dụng thực tế không phải là một chặng đường dễ dàng, nhưng với sự chuẩn bị kỹ lưỡng và hướng dẫn đúng đắn, bạn hoàn toàn có thể đạt được mục tiêu. Bài viết này sẽ cung cấp cho bạn một lộ trình chi tiết, giúp bạn nắm vững kiến thức lý thuyết và ứng dụng thực tế, từ đó xây dựng sự nghiệp vững chắc trong lĩnh vực đầy tiềm năng này. Stonenetwork Edu sẽ hỗ trợ bạn trên hành trình này bằng các khóa học chất lượng cao, giúp bạn nhanh chóng thành thạo các kỹ năng cần thiết và sẵn sàng đáp ứng nhu cầu của thị trường.
Hiểu rõ về Blockchain: Khởi đầu vững chắc cho lộ trình
Trước khi bắt đầu tìm hiểu về lập trình, bạn cần có một nền tảng kiến thức vững chắc về công nghệ Blockchain. Điều này bao gồm hiểu biết về các khái niệm cơ bản như: blockchain là gì, cách thức hoạt động của nó, các loại blockchain khác nhau (public, private, consortium), cryptography, consensus mechanism (Proof-of-Work, Proof-of-Stake, ...), smart contracts, và các ứng dụng thực tiễn của blockchain trong các lĩnh vực khác nhau như tài chính, logistics, healthcare, etc. Hãy dành thời gian nghiên cứu các tài liệu, bài viết, và video hướng dẫn uy tín để có một cái nhìn tổng quan và sâu sắc về công nghệ này.
Lựa chọn ngôn ngữ lập trình phù hợp
Có nhiều ngôn ngữ lập trình được sử dụng trong phát triển blockchain, và lựa chọn ngôn ngữ phù hợp sẽ giúp bạn tối ưu hóa quá trình học tập và phát triển. Một số ngôn ngữ lập trình phổ biến bao gồm: Solidity (cho Ethereum), C++, Java, Python, Go. Tùy thuộc vào mục tiêu và dự án bạn muốn tham gia, bạn có thể lựa chọn ngôn ngữ phù hợp. Ví dụ, nếu bạn muốn phát triển smart contract trên Ethereum, Solidity là lựa chọn hàng đầu. Tuy nhiên, việc học thêm nhiều ngôn ngữ lập trình sẽ giúp bạn đa dạng hóa kỹ năng và mở rộng cơ hội nghề nghiệp.
Thực hành xây dựng các dự án nhỏ
Thực hành là chìa khóa để thành công trong bất kỳ lĩnh vực nào, đặc biệt là lập trình. Sau khi đã nắm vững kiến thức lý thuyết, hãy bắt đầu xây dựng các dự án nhỏ để áp dụng những gì bạn đã học. Bạn có thể bắt đầu với các dự án đơn giản như: xây dựng một blockchain đơn giản, tạo một smart contract cơ bản, hoặc tích hợp blockchain vào một ứng dụng hiện có. Việc này sẽ giúp bạn làm quen với quá trình phát triển, xử lý lỗi và cải thiện kỹ năng lập trình của mình.
Tham gia cộng đồng và học hỏi kinh nghiệm từ người khác
Cộng đồng blockchain rất năng động và phát triển mạnh mẽ. Hãy tham gia vào các diễn đàn, nhóm thảo luận, và các sự kiện liên quan đến blockchain để học hỏi kinh nghiệm từ những người khác, chia sẻ kiến thức và nhận được sự hỗ trợ từ cộng đồng. Việc này sẽ giúp bạn cập nhật những xu hướng mới nhất, giải quyết các vấn đề phát sinh trong quá trình học tập và làm việc.
Tìm hiểu về các framework và thư viện
Để tiết kiệm thời gian và tăng hiệu quả trong quá trình phát triển, hãy tìm hiểu và sử dụng các framework và thư viện hỗ trợ. Các framework và thư viện này cung cấp các công cụ và chức năng sẵn có, giúp bạn tập trung vào logic và chức năng chính của dự án. Một số framework và thư viện phổ biến bao gồm: Truffle, Hardhat (cho Solidity), Web3.js (cho JavaScript).
Làm thế nào để ứng dụng kiến thức vào thực tế?
- Tham gia các cuộc thi hackathon về Blockchain.
- Tìm kiếm các cơ hội thực tập tại các công ty công nghệ.
- Xây dựng portfolio dự án cá nhân để chứng minh năng lực.
- Tham gia các khóa học chuyên sâu về Blockchain Development.
- Kết nối với các chuyên gia trong ngành để tìm kiếm hướng đi phù hợp.
Lộ trình Blockchain Developer: Từ lý thuyết đến ứng dụng thực tế đòi hỏi sự kiên trì, nỗ lực và đam mê. Tuy nhiên, với sự chuẩn bị kỹ lưỡng và hướng dẫn đúng đắn, bạn hoàn toàn có thể đạt được mục tiêu của mình. Stonenetwork Edu tự hào là đối tác đồng hành đáng tin cậy, cung cấp cho bạn những khóa học chất lượng cao, giúp bạn nhanh chóng thành thạo các kỹ năng cần thiết và sẵn sàng đáp ứng nhu cầu của thị trường.
Hãy bắt đầu với Stonenetwork Edu ngay hôm nay! Đăng ký dùng thử miễn phí
Điện thoại: 0934 880 85505 Comments

Multiply sea night grass fourth day sea lesser rule open subdue female fill which them Blessed, give fill lesser bearing multiply sea night grass fourth day sea lesser
Emilly Blunt
December 4, 2017 at 3:12 pm

Multiply sea night grass fourth day sea lesser rule open subdue female fill which them Blessed, give fill lesser bearing multiply sea night grass fourth day sea lesser
Emilly Blunt
December 4, 2017 at 3:12 pm
Multiply sea night grass fourth day sea lesser rule open subdue female fill which them Blessed, give fill lesser bearing multiply sea night grass fourth day sea lesser
Emilly Blunt
December 4, 2017 at 3:12 pm